Richard H. Capps papers, 1961-2003

Creator(s): Capps, Richard H.
Date(s): 1961-2003
Extent: 17.48 cu.ft.
Biographical Note: Richard H. Capps was born on June 22, 1944 in Columbia, South Carolina. He received an Associate of Arts from North Greenville College in 1965. In 1967, he earned a Bachelor of Arts from Furman University. He received a Master of Theology and a Doctor of Ministry from New Orleans Baptist Theological Seminary in 1970 and 1978, respectively. In 1965, he became an ordained minister. He pastored several churches including: Fairfield Baptist Church in Winnsboro, South Carolina; Calvary Church in Columbia, South Carolina; First Baptist Church in Gaston; and Laurel Baptist Church in Greenville, North Carolina. In addition, he served as the Director of Missions for the South Roanoke Baptist Association and the Liberty Baptist Association.  

Scope and Contents: This collection contains materials collected and used by Richard H. Capps from 1961-2003. It includes various research materials. The majority of these materials are booklets and pamphlets published by the Southern Baptist Convention and the Home Mission Board. This collection also contains materials regarding the churches and Baptist associations Capps served. These materials include church directories, church minutes, and associational meetings. In addition, the Capps Collection contains training materials for church leaders and members. Included are folders on lay evangelism and church development regarding outreach ministries.

Arrangement: 
Series 1: Research records, 1961-2003
Series 2: Church/Association records, 1969-2002
Series 3: Training materials, 1963-1998
